Dan Millman describes a way of life where the focused attention of the gymnast is applied to all facets of daily life — from eating and walking to working and relating with others. Generally we blame our emotions on conditions outside of ourselves to which we react. Seldom do we choose to take responsibility for our own feelings. In this dynamic, two-part program, Millman suggests that we can find happiness if we commit ourselves to being present to the “now” moments of life. By being open to the power of each moment we find within ourselves naturally unfolding talents such as clairvoyance and telepathy.

Dan Millman, author of Way of the Peaceful Warrior, is a former world trampoline champion and co-captain of the 1968 University of California NCAA champion gymnastics team. He has coached gymnastics at Stanford, Oberlin and Berkeley.
